OMG, i got rocked so hard by a DD after attacking a convoy he almost sunk me.
With some tricky use of the blow ballasts and then leveling off before i get to the surface (then sink back down), i was able to keep from sinking long enough for my crew to repair the bulkheads and pump out the water just as i was about to run out of compressed air. But.. Both prop shafts were damaged, 2 diesel engines destroyed, and 2 electric engines destroyed. I was able to surface once the DD's went away and spent the next few days on the surface waiting for the crew to repair the shafts. Finally they fixed them, but im still dead in the water. Why, if i still have 2 diesels and 2 electrics functional can i not move? http://i.imgur.com/z1HqWlg.png |

Remember, SH4 only "simulates" two engines each, not the four. Going by your image, both sets of engines (and motors) are out of commission, no propulsion, and they are not on the list to be repaired. I don't know how a boat ends up with diesels (especially) "destroyed" when a boat is submerged, but the electrics... well... it's probably that, since the diesels drive the electricity that supplies the electric motors that actually drives the shafts, so therefore, the diesels are showing as destroyed?? Speculation here, that maybe they attempt to "simulate" that?? My question though would be, what could be so catastrophic that at least one of the electric motors won't turn?... maybe to where a person could do like 5 or 6 knots?...

Another surprising thing: as long as you are charging batteries you are using fuel at the same rate as ahead emergency. This is why you want to have batteries at 100% as much of the time as possible. Too many people think that they're cruising at 9 knots so they don't have to worry about fuel. That isn't necessarily true if you're not on top of your battery state.
